i buy all of the plastic bags i use by the case...i have a place that has excellent prices but you have to buy 1000 of whatever size you use..you can buy almost everything there..all kinds of bags and other packaging supplies , labels etc..
      www.packagingsupplies.com

nowadays almost all bags made need to be food safe...so pretty much any that you buy will be ok for fish..i have been buying from this company for about 8 years and have had no problems whatsoever...

Ken's Fish or Jehmco.com  Both are about the same in price, slightly different sizes and both don't seem to have issues with pin holes or bad bottom seams.
